In a landmark achievement for Pakistan’s scientific community, Prof. Dr. Muhammad Liaquat Raza has been appointed to the editorial board of "Neuroscience," the official journal of the International Brain Research Organization (IBRO). This prestigious recognition makes him the first Pakistani scientist to hold this esteemed position.
Currently serving at King Abdulaziz Medical City in Saudi Arabia, Prof. Raza is a distinguished Professor of Neuroscience, Pharmacology, and Health Informatics with over 20 years of experience in research, teaching, and scientific leadership. His appointment to IBRO’s editorial board highlights his exceptional contributions to neuroscience and medical research at an international level.
About the IBRO Journal "Neuroscience"
Founded in 1976, "Neuroscience" is IBRO’s flagship, peer-reviewed journal that publishes cutting-edge research on neuroscience, brain function, neurological disorders, and clinical studies. It is one of the world’s leading publications in brain research, featuring fundamental science, meta-analyses, and clinical innovations.
Prof. Dr. Muhammad Liaquat Raza’s Contributions to Neuroscience
Prof. Raza’s research expertise covers a broad spectrum of fields, including:
✅ Drug Discovery & Medicinal Natural Products
✅ Epilepsy, Parkinson’s Disease & Depression Research
✅ Pain Management & Oncology Studies
✅ Artificial Intelligence (AI) in Healthcare
He completed his doctorate in Medical Neuroscience from Charité University of Medicine-Berlin, Germany, and has held postdoctoral fellowships at prestigious institutions worldwide. His vast contributions to neuroscience and pharmacology have made him a leading figure in brain research and health informatics.
